Report: Arda Turan to leave Barcelona

A report claims that Barcelona are ready to sell Arda Turan in this summer's transfer window, which has placed Manchester United and Arsenal on red alert.

Barcelona are reportedly prepared to sell Arda Turan at the end of the season, less than 12 months after bringing the Turkish international to Camp Nou.

Turan cost Barcelona upwards of £25m from Atletico Madrid in last summer's transfer window, but was banned from making his official debut until the start of 2016 due to the club's transfer embargo.

The attacker has played just 816 minutes of La Liga football in 2016 and it is understood that his relationship with head coach Luis Enrique has broken down due to a lack of playing time.

Earlier this month, Turan claimed that he 'would remain patient' at Camp Nou, but according to The Mirror, both Manchester United and Arsenal want to bring the 29-year-old to the Premier League.

Turan is expected to be in the Barcelona squad for Sunday's Copa del Rey final against Sevilla.
